The Minnawarra Historic Precinct offers a chance to absorb some of Armadale’s fascinating local history. Visit the History House Museum to view a range of interesting displays. Check out the Birtwistle Local Studies Library before immersing yourself in the reverence of yesteryear at the Minnawarra Chapel.

The chapel, was originally built in 1903, and was relocated brick by brick to its current location in 1987. Enjoy the calming sanctuary whilst taking in the lovely lake outlook. The Local Studies Library is housed in the old Armadale Primary School, which was built in 1900.

The parklands surrounding the Historic Precinct provide a great spot for a picnic with a large lake, paved and shaded picnic areas, expansive lawns and a variety of water birds to keep you company.

Armadale is a 30 minute drive southeast of the city, and is well serviced by busses and trains.
